The unemployment rate in Center Harbor, NH, is 3.30%, with job growth of 2.89%.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 42.48%.

Center Harbor, NH Taxes

Center Harbor, NH,sales tax rate is 0.00%. Income tax is 5.00%.

Center Harbor, NH Income and Salaries

The income per capita is $33,111, which includes all adults and children. The median household income is $64,065.
